Comprehending UK Cot Safety Standards
Before diving into particular models, it is essential to comprehend what makes a cot safe in the United Kingdom. All cots sold in the UK needs to abide by stringent British and European safety standards, specifically BS EN 716-1:2017+AIR CONDITIONER:2019.
When looking for the very best cots in the UK, moms and dads need to constantly search for:
- Bar Spacing: Gaps in between cot bars need to be in between 4.5 cm and 6.5 cm to avoid a Baby beds's head from ending up being trapped.
- Bed mattress Firmness: The bed mattress needs to fit comfortably without any spaces larger than 3 cm on any side.
- Non-Toxic Finishes: Teething rails and paints must be totally safe for infants who like to chew on furnishings.
- Adjustable Base Heights: Essential for decreasing the mattress as the baby grows and learns to sit or stand.

- )Q: Do I need a Moses basket, or can my baby go straight into a cot? A: A baby can oversleep a full-sized cot from birth, provided it has a company, flat, and properly fitted bed mattress. Many UK parents utilize a Moses basket or bedside crib for the first couple of months just because it takes up less area in the moms and dads'bedroom and develops a cosier environment for a newborn. Q: When should I decrease the cot mattress base? A: You need to reduce the mattress base as quickly as your baby shows signs of rolling over(around 3 to 4 months)
- or when they can sit up unaided( around 6 months ). This prevents them from being able to pull themselves up and topple over the leading rail. Q: Are pre-owned cots safe to use? A: While hand-me-downs are fantastic for the environment and your wallet, the
Lullaby Trust suggests buying a brand-newbed mattress for every new baby to decrease the risk of SIDS (Sudden Infant Death Syndrome).If using a pre-owned cot frame, completely examine that it meets existing UK safety standards, has no missing parts, which the drop-side system (if applicable)works perfectly.
